Output 4c68ad3c4b74ad129c111c14dab2ae4d0ba772b77f2991e8b40e828e183f8946:0

value
142895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0872a814b17286c619f312f9922d08deba9d228 OP_EQUAL
address
3LhcPwn7c5gRGq5NfLKVCGPoctXRKYdgvC
transaction
4c68ad3c4b74ad129c111c14dab2ae4d0ba772b77f2991e8b40e828e183f8946
confirmations
315281
spent
true